History / Previous Identities:
1945: 3rd Air Force at Chatham Field, FL
1948: Kearney AFB, 27 FG for fighter escorts for SAC
1950: Texas Air National Guard, 182nd TFS, Brooks
1950: Tactical Air Command, 136th FBW, Langley
1952: Air Defense Command, 109th FIS, Holman
1958: Surplused by USAF
1958: N7723C (Trans Florida Aviation) modified to Cavalier Mk.2
1960: Dominican Republic Air Force as FAD 1919 #2
1984: return to USA (O'Farrell)
1986: N51DJ (#2) restoration as "Tally Ho II" (Jerry Miles)
1999: N51DJ paint stripped (Aero Craft Services)
2000: N1251D (Classic American Aircraft, Inc.) restoration
2000: N1251D Flying (October 2000)
2002: (May) shipped to Mike Vadeboncoeur's
Midwest Aero Restorations, Ltd. in Danville, Illinois
for full restoration.
2004: N74469, restoration as Major Louis H. Norley's "Red Dog"
2006: unveiled at Oshkosh Airventure in July. The restoration is first class. Take a very close look at the workmanship, it is excellent. "Red Dog" won Reserve Grand Champion at EAA Airventure, congratulations Dan and Mike!
2007: Ron Pratt of Chandler Az
